Common Issues and Errors Related to F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ll
Although essential for system performance, dynamic Link Library (DLL) files can occasionally cause specific errors. The following enumerates some of the most common DLL errors users encounter while operating their systems:
- F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ll could not be loaded: This error suggests that the system was unable to load the DLL file into memory. This could happen due to file corruption, incompatibility, or because the file is missing or incorrectly installed.
- F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message indicates that the DLL file is either not compatible with your Windows version or has an internal problem. It could be due to a programming error in the DLL, or an attempt to use a DLL from a different version of Windows.
- This application failed to start because F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This message suggests that the application is trying to run a DLL file that it can't locate, which may be due to deletion or displacement of the DLL file. Reinstallation could potentially restore the necessary DLL file to its correct location.
- The file F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.
- F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ll Access Violation: This indicates a process tried to access or modify a memory location related to F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ll that it isn't allowed to. This is often a sign of problems with the software using the DLL, such as bugs or corruption.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ll Error
In this guide, we will fix FlashUtil32_32_0_0_192_Plugin.dll errors by scanning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Promptin the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
sfc /scannowand press Enter. -
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.
